  • Patent number: 7736618
    Abstract: The invention relates to a reaction vessel in which hydrogen sulphide is produced from sulphur and hydrogen, wherein the reaction vessel is partially or completely made up of a material which is resistant to the reaction mixture and its compounds and/or elements and which remains resistant even at high temperatures.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 2, 2007
    Date of Patent: June 15, 2010
    Assignee: Evonik Degussa GmbH
    Inventors: Hubert Redlingshoefer, Karl-Guenther Schuetze, Christoph Weckbecker, Klaus Huthmacher
